Water Fed Poles: A Smarter Way to Clean Windows – Water fed poles have transformed professional window cleaning across the UK by allowing cleaners to work safely and efficiently from the ground. Using purified water delivered through a telescopic pole, dirt and grime are lifted and rinsed away without the need for detergents or ladders. One of the biggest advantages is the time saved on every job. Cleaners no longer need to carry, position, or constantly move ladders between windows, which significantly speeds up the cleaning process. A water fed pole allows smooth, uninterrupted cleaning across large areas, making it ideal for both domestic and commercial properties. Because the cleaner remains on the ground, effort and physical strain are reduced, helping maintain productivity throughout the day. This is particularly beneficial for long jobs or multi-storey buildings where fatigue can slow progress. In addition, purified water dries spot-free, leaving windows cleaner for longer and reducing callbacks.
